What to do with an old couch - Wash the Upholstery. Combine a half teaspoon of dye-free dish soap and warm water in a small bucket, frothing the mixture up to create suds. Dip an upholstery brush into the suds and gently run it across the upholstery, taking care not to soak the fabric. Finish the job by wiping the fabric with a clean, damp cloth.

 
If your old couch is in good condition, the furniture dealer might offer you a discount coupon for future purchases or a bargain on the new couch. On the other hand, if your old couch has a lot of wear and tear on it, the dealer might end up dropping off the shipping charges on the new couch or reject the deal altogether. Hold a yard or garage sale. If you have other items you want to get rid of, you can hold a garage or yard sale and include your old couch. This can be a fun way to declutter your home and make some extra cash. You can also consider getting a couple of neighbors together for a larger sale, which will draw more buyers. How to Donate Old Furniture. A better way to get rid of unwanted furniture is by donating it to a local charity. National charities such as the Salvation Army, Goodwill, and Habitat for Humanity are a few good places to start. Some charities will even come and pick up your donated furniture, usually for a fee. Remove the couch legs, by unscrewing them off counter-clockwise by hand or with the screwdriver or drill. Remove the black dust cover by carefully cutting it away. For a cleaner removal, pry away the staples that hold the dust cover to the couch’s wooden frame.
